This course conclusion project is linked to the work of the research group at the Chronology and Chronometry Center of UNESP-Rio Claro and also proposes the application of morphometric analysis techniques of the drainage network, by applying Slope Index Value and Extension methods and also the application of longitudinal profile in the far east of the southeast region, more precisely on the border between the states of São Paulo and Rio de Janeiro, in the geomorphological sub-zone of Serra da Bocaina. The research was conducted in the watershed of Jacuí river, in order to outline neotectonical influences and structural controls on the landscape configuration, and also sort the drainage network in relation to the proposed standards in the literature so far today

Purpose: This population-based, cross-sectional study aimed to record the DMFT index for 12 year-old children with dental caries and fluorosis levels in cities with and without public water supply fluoridation. Methods: From the 101 municipalities belonging to the Health Regional Department XV (DRSXV-SJRP) of the São Paulo state in the Southeast region of Brazil, 85 cities were selected after exclusion of those with incomplete data and less than ten years of fluoridation treatment in 2004. The criteria adopted for the assessment of dental caries and fluorosis levels were based on the guidelines published in the WHO Manual 4th edition. The data were analyzed using Fisher’s exact tests at a significance level of 5%. Results: The prevalence of caries in 12 year-old children had no significant association with fluoridated water, and was considered “moderate” and “high” in cities without fluoridation and “low” and “moderate” in cities with fluoridation. A significant association was found between water fluoridation and fluorosis (P=0.001), but not between water fluoridation and the DMFT index (P=0.119). Conclusion: The prevalence of fluorosis was related to water fluoridation in this study. However, fluorosis was also observed in non-fluoridated cities, which may result from fluoride intake through other sources.

Purpose: The aim of this study was to test the association between quality of sleep and stress in individuals with temporomandibular disorder (TMD). Methods: The study sample consisted of 354 adult subjects (males and females) from the municipality of Piacatu, São Paulo state, in the Southeast region of Brazil. Data were collected using the Fonseca’s Questionnaire to record the level of TMD, the Pittsburgh Sleep Quality Index (PSQI) to assess quality of sleep and the Social Readjustment Rating Scale (SRRS) to record stress level. The data were analyzed by the software Epi Info 2000 version 3.2 using a chi-square test at the 0.05 level of significance. Results: One hundred and eighty (50.8%) subjects had some level of TMD. The statistical analysis showed a significant relationship between the three stress scores and the presence or absence of sleep disorders, considering an overall PSQI score > 5 as an indicator of a subject with sleep problems (P<0.01). Conclusion: Both quality of sleep and stress levels were associated with TMD in this sample.

Bauru: region of cerrado ou forest? The city of Bauru is located in São Paulo State, where the maps showing native vegetation distribution does not clearly defi ne its nature. In order to clarify which types of native vegetation was found in this region, a bibliographic survey was performed, ranging from ancient documents prepared by naturalists describing this region and recent research results of floristic and phytosociological character. It is concluded that in Bauru, semideciduous seasonal forests overlays the northwestern and that cerrado comes over the southeast region. In riparian areas where the cerrado prevailed, there are still traces of swamp forests and swamp grasslands. In the border areas between forests and cerrado, the occurrence of vegetation transition is common, with two distinct types of it and other typical of these ecotone zones.

The penaeidean Litopenaeus schmitti, popularly known as white shrimp, is a species of great economic importance, being a target of fishing fleets in the southeast region of Brazil. It is distributed through the western Atlantic, from Cuba to Brazil, until Rio Grande do Sul. Adults are found from shallow depths up to 30 m and have been found to depths of 47 m in the state of Rio de Janeiro, while juveniles are located in bays and estuaries. The studied species is seasonally distributed in the region of Ubatuba. The objectives of this study are to analyze the abundance and ecological distribution of L. schmitti and to assess if and when juveniles use the Indaia estuary during their life cycle. Furthermore, the hypothesis was tested that the main period of recruitment in the bay coincides with the period of closure of fisheries defined by the Instruction of IBAMA. To that end, samples were taken monthly from July 2005 through June 2007, both in Ubatuba Bay and in the estuary formed by the Rio Indaia. At each sampling station, salinity, temperature (bottom), depth, organic matter content (%), and grain size of sediments were measured. We found that the largest catches in the estuary were in late spring and early summer. In Ubatuba Bay, peak catches occurred during winter and early spring, whereas in the second year, already in May, there was a high peak capture. The variation in the number of individuals was correlated with some environmental factors both in the estuary and in the inlet (p < 0.05). In the estuary, abundance was positively correlated with temperature (p = 0.008) and organic matter (p = 0.025) and negatively with depth (p = 0.009). Regarding the Ubatuba Bay, only temperature (p = 0.034) and depth (p = 0.013) were significantly associated with the distribution of the shrimp, both being negative relations. The shrimp L. schmitti uses both the estuarine as well the shore environment, particularly the Ubatuba estuary and its adjacent bay, to complete its life cycle. The proposed period of fisheries closure (between March to May in the state of Sao Paulo) for this and other shrimps coincides with individuals capable of reproduction entering the inlet and thus are being protected.

The distribution of heavy metals in recent sediments deposited along the Tiete River, a highly polluted river in southeast region of Brazil was studied. Around the metropolitan area of Silo Paulo city (25 million people), the pollution is related to municipal wastes and industrial effluents with reinforced downstream by agricultural activities. The observed increase of heavy metal concentrations is particularly important for Zn in the upper basin and Cu, Co and Cr at mouth. Geo-accumulation index calculation, related to the regional background, showed that the sediments along the basin are seriously polluted by heavy metals of anthropogenic origin, mainly Cu, Co, Cr and Zn. Calculated index suggests medium to very strongly pollution.
